JORDAN is a circuit judge assigned to the Domestic Relations Division of the Circuit Court of Cook County, Illinois. He has been assigned to that division as a trial judge since he came onto the bench on August 1, 1994. Before coming to the bench, Judge Jordan was in private practice for 22 years, most of which were spent as a trial lawyer in the area of family law. He also was a member of the Federal Trial Bar. He is a 1972 graduate of the John Marshall Law School and a 1975 Diplomat of the Trial Technique Clinic of the Lawyers Post Graduate Clinics in Chicago. Judge Jordan also is a member of several professional associations. He is a past president of the Decalogue Society of Lawyers, and he is currently a member of the Illinois State Bar Association Assembly. Judge Jordan is a frequent lecturer and panel participant in programs of continuing education for lawyers and judges, he regularly judges mock trial and moot court competitions, and he often speaks to civic and other groups on the law. Judge Katz was appointed to the bench in November, 1999. Since April, 2000 she has been assigned to the Domestic Relations Division, where she presides over an individual calendar. Judge Katz is a 1983 graduate of Chicago-Kent College of Law. From 1995-1999 she served as Assistant General Counsel for the Illinois Department of Children and Family Services, where she supervised the legal work of the Department in the Cook County Child Protection and Juvenile Justice Divisions of the Circuit Court of Cook County. Prior to that, Judge Katz worked for more than 10 years as a staff attorney, supervising attorney and project director for the Legal Assistance Foundation of Chicago. She also served for one and a half years as the Assistant Ethics Counsel for the American Bar Association's Center for Professional Responsibility.
